  4. Oct 5, 2012 · Liberal Arts: Directed by Josh Radnor. With Josh Radnor, Elizabeth Olsen, Richard Jenkins, Allison Janney. When 30-something Jesse returns to his alma mater for a professor's retirement party, he falls for Zibby, a college student, and is faced with a powerful attraction that springs up between them.

    Sep 14, 2012 · Newly single, 35, and uninspired by his job, Jesse Fisher worries that his best days are behind him. But no matter how much he buries his head in a book, life keeps pulling Jesse back. When his favorite college professor invites him to campus to speak at his retirement dinner, Jesse jumps at the chance.
